1.
The generalized eigenstates of the higher power of the annihilation operator for a non harmonic oscillator are constructed It is found that they form a complete Hilbert space.
构造了非简谐振子湮没算符高次幂的广义本征态,发现它们构成完备Hilbert空间。
2.
The inverse operators of creation and annihilation operators for a harmonic oscillator are introduced.
本文引入谐振子产生算符和湮没算符的逆算符,导出了它们在Fock空间的表达式,并给出了一些简单应用。
3.
The eigenstates of the second power of the annihilation operator of the twoparameter deformed harmonic oscillator are constructed, and their completeness is demonstrated in terms of the qs-integration.
明显构造了双参数形变谐振子湮没算符二次幂的本征态,并利用qs积分给出了其完备性的证明。
